WebMar 12, 2024 · Gratuity is a lump sum that a company pays when an employee leaves an organization and is one of the many retirement benefits offered by a company to an employee. In India, gratuity rules and requirements are set out under the Payment of Gratuity Act, 1972. An employer may also choose to pay gratuity outside of that which …
WebFeb 8, 2024 · Gratuity As per the Payments of Gratuity Act, gratuity is payable to an employee who has served the company for 4 years and 10 months or more. Any employee resigning from the job or being terminated after completion of this period is entitled to receive gratuity payment within 30 days.
